• We are to respect each child as God's creation in and offer equal opportunity to learn without discrimination.
  • We believe that evidence of differentiated teaching and lessons observing multiple intelligences should be regularly practiced in the classroom offering each unique learning style an opportunity to show proficiency and access the academic material.
  • Parent involvement is crucial to the success of a school and educators should provide platforms for regular involvement of parents and ongoing access to the learning that is happening in the classroom.
  • Excellence in character is at the foundation and core of a successful adult and should be introduced, modeled and taught to all children by educators exemplifying excellence in character. A clear, planned and thoroughly executed character building program is crucial to the success of any school and should be integrated into all facets of the school’s culture and events.
  • A diverse student body offers many benefits to the worldview of each student. Students from many nationalities and languages bring depth to an educational program allowing a real world experience in the classroom in the area of English language learners, cultural diversity, varied perspectives in class discussion and most importantly a tolerance and acceptance of all people no matter nationality, language, or race.
  • We encourage creativity through all forms of art and skills, verbal and non-verbal, written and non-written forms of expression. We are provide platforms for our students to discover their gifting of creativity and the potential they have in creating something from nothing without holding bias or criticism to the product but only satisfaction in creating.
